当前位置: 首页 > 专利查询>浙江大学专利>正文

基于可编程硬件DPU的Sketch实时网络测量方法、电子设备、介质技术

技术编号:42336124 阅读:18 留言:0更新日期:2024-08-14 16:11
本发明专利技术公开了一种基于可编程硬件DPU的Sketch实时网络测量方法、电子设备、介质,所述方法包括以下步骤:将Sketch程序转换为JSON格式的中间表示,记为将Sketch程序的中间表示抽象为一组原子化的数据结构和数据处理操作,记为其中,表示的数据结构的集合,表示的数据处理操作的集合;获取每一在DPU上运行的资源消耗数据,包括:根据的数据结构获取存储资源,根据的数据处理操作获取SoC核心数量;以DPU的资源限制为约束条件,以最小化所有内存访问延迟的总和为目标,求解Sketch卸载至DPU的最优卸载策略;基于最优卸载策略,将Sketch编译加载到DPU上。

【技术实现步骤摘要】

本专利技术涉及网络测量领域,尤其涉及一种基于可编程硬件dpu的sketch实时网络测量方法、电子设备、介质。


技术介绍

1、现代生产网络依赖于高效的数据传输、可靠的连接性和稳定的性能来支持各种任务和业务需求。现代网络的拓扑结构更加复杂,网络流量大幅增长,随之带来了高延迟、高丢包率、网络拥塞等问题。网络测量技术在这样网络环境下扮演着至关重要的角色:①性能监测。监测延迟、丢包率、带宽利用率等网络性能指标,确保网络稳定高效运行。②故障诊断。当网络出现故障或性能下降时,提供实时数据以识别网络中的瓶颈、拥塞或故障点。③安全性。网络测量技术可帮助识别异常行为和潜在的安全威胁,检测和预防各种网络攻击。

2、p4(programming protocol-independent packet processors)是一门描述数据平面设备的数据报处理行为的领域专用语言。p4允许用户编写数据报处理逻辑并在网络设备上进行部署,而无需依赖特定的硬件或协议。在可编程数据平面,p4是一种事实上的标准语言,并且已经被许多系统用于实现sketch。

3、数据处理单本文档来自技高网...

【技术保护点】

1.一种基于可编程硬件DPU的Sketch实时网络测量方法,其特征在于,所述方法包括以下步骤:

2.根据权利要求1所述的一种基于可编程硬件DPU的Sketch实时网络测量方法,其特征在于,Sketch的数据结构的集合记录流量统计数据;在中,共有个计数器数组,第i个数组有个计数器,每个计数器的长度为位;

3.根据权利要求1所述的一种基于可编程硬件DPU的Sketch实时网络测量方法,其特征在于,根据Sketch的数据结构获取存储资源包括:

4.根据权利要求1所述的一种基于可编程硬件DPU的Sketch实时网络测量方法,其特征在于,根据Sketch的数据处...

【技术特征摘要】

1.一种基于可编程硬件dpu的sketch实时网络测量方法,其特征在于,所述方法包括以下步骤:

2.根据权利要求1所述的一种基于可编程硬件dpu的sketch实时网络测量方法,其特征在于,sketch的数据结构的集合记录流量统计数据;在中,共有个计数器数组,第i个数组有个计数器,每个计数器的长度为位;

3.根据权利要求1所述的一种基于可编程硬件dpu的sketch实时网络测量方法,其特征在于,根据sketch的数据结构获取存储资源包括:

4.根据权利要求1所述的一种基于可编程硬件dpu的sketch实时网络测量方法,其特征在于,根据sketch的数据处理操作获取soc核心数量包括:

5.根据权利要求1所述的一种基于可编程硬件 dpu 的 sketch 实时网络测量方法,其特征在于,以dpu的资源限制为约束条件,以最小化所有sketch内存访问延迟的总和为目标,求解sketch卸载至dpu的最优卸载策略包括:

6.根据权利要求5所述的...

【专利技术属性】
技术研发人员:吴春明谭挥毫陈翔刘宏岩
申请(专利权)人:浙江大学
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1